我正在尝试修复 Chef 安装/配置 ClamAV 配方中的一个问题,该问题是由该配方在某些平台上对 clam 服务帐户使用了错误的默认用户/组名造成的。
看起来:
- 在 CentOS 6 上,服务帐户是“clam”
- 在 Fedora 19 上,服务帐户是“clamupdate”
- 在 Ubuntu 12.04 上,服务帐户是“clamav”。
基于此,我猜测该模式可以概括(以 Chef 术语来说)为:
- Debian 家族——“clamav”
- RHEL 家族——“蛤蜊”
- Fedora 家族——“clamupdate”
问题:
我是否把这个问题过于简单化了?
有人知道与此相矛盾的例子吗?(让我们假设我们正在讨论针对各个平台的“推荐” RPM / DEB...)